- Funding for 435 Student Success Scholarships for qualified students to ensure no student on track to graduate is dropped due to inability to pay tuition.
- Support of the innovative WomenLead program, a Signature Experience that develops female student leadership through endowed scholarships.
- Funding to establish the WomenLead in Technology program.
- Contributions to the Women’s Excellence Fund in Athletics which develops programming to support female student-athletes.
- Funding of an intern to staff the Women’s Collection at the GSU Library that chronicles women’s activism and advocacy in Georgia and the Southeast.
- $75,000 to the Emergency Assistance Fund for students during the pandemic.
- Creation of the first undergraduate endowed Scholarship in the School of Public Health to honor President Mark Becker.
- A Voting Rights series that began with the commemoration of the passage of the 19th Amendment.
- A celebration of President Mark Becker’s tenure at GSU
- Panel discussions with University and community experts on Understanding the Impact of COVID-19 on Women and School-Aged Children
- A Virtual Introduction with President M. Brian Blake, GSU’s eighth president
